Abstract

741,030. Treating liquids with gases. UNITED KINGDOM ATOMIC ENERGY AUTHORITY. Nov. 3, 1954 [Nov. 3, 1953], No. 30293/53. Class 55 (2). Random packed elements for gas and liquid contact columns &c. comprise a star-shaped lamina with an even number of points and one or more central apertures 8, the points 1 ... 6 being bent alternately in opposite directions through about 120 degrees to meet at apices on opposite sides of a polygonal part 7. In the form shown the element is constructed from a sixpointed metal lamina,.- the distance between the apices being about the maximum diameter of the hexagonal portion, i.e. of the order of ¢ inch.
